I had this idea a while ago and it still is marinading in the back hearths of my mind.

I would like to see if it were possible to play as a covenant of magi writing letters in the first person. Something like Ars Magica meets De Profundis. All activity of characters would happen through first person letters between various characters. I have played De Profundis but, while I own Ars Magica, I have never played it. I like the idea of a Covenant, its creation, maintenance and livelihood but really am put-off by the depth of the rules.

Is this something that anyone in their right mind would play? I just had to throw it out there.

I failed to mention to wingnut, that De Profundis barely has any rules, more like categories. What is no doubt important is the Charter, which is simply deciding what we will write about and its parameters. This is also true of Ars Magica.
